Understanding Smart Home Basics
Smart home tech connects everyday devices to the internet. These devices communicate with each other and respond to user commands through Wi-Fi, Bluetooth, Zigbee, or Z-Wave protocols. Each protocol has strengths, Wi-Fi offers wide compatibility, while Zigbee and Z-Wave create mesh networks that extend range and reduce interference.
The core concept is simple: sensors detect conditions (motion, temperature, light), and connected devices respond accordingly. A motion sensor can trigger lights to turn on. A thermostat can adjust heating based on whether anyone is home. These interactions happen automatically once configured.
Smart home tech falls into several categories:
- Lighting: Smart bulbs and switches that dim, change colors, and operate on schedules
- Climate control: Thermostats and fans that optimize energy usage
- Security: Cameras, doorbells, and locks that monitor and protect homes
- Entertainment: Speakers and displays that stream music and video
- Appliances: Plugs and switches that control any device with an outlet
Most smart home tech requires three components: the device itself, a smartphone app for control, and an internet connection. Some devices also need a central hub to function. Understanding these basics helps homeowners make smart purchasing decisions and avoid compatibility headaches later.
Choosing The Right Smart Hub
A smart hub acts as the brain of a connected home. It receives commands and coordinates communication between devices from different manufacturers. Without a hub, smart home tech from various brands might not work together.
Three major ecosystems dominate the market: Amazon Alexa, Google Home, and Apple HomeKit. Each has distinct advantages.
Amazon Alexa supports the widest range of third-party devices. Echo speakers and displays double as hubs, making entry affordable. Alexa excels at voice control and offers thousands of “skills” that extend functionality.
Google Home integrates tightly with Google services like Calendar and Maps. The Google Assistant handles natural language queries better than competitors. Nest devices work seamlessly within this ecosystem.
Apple HomeKit prioritizes privacy and security. All communication stays encrypted, and Apple doesn’t store recordings on external servers. HomeKit requires devices to meet strict certification standards, which limits options but ensures quality.
Some homeowners prefer dedicated hubs like SmartThings or Hubitat. These support multiple protocols (Zigbee, Z-Wave, Wi-Fi) and offer advanced automation capabilities. Power users appreciate the flexibility, though setup requires more effort.
The Matter standard, launched in late 2022, promises to bridge these ecosystems. Devices certified for Matter work across all major platforms. As adoption grows, choosing a hub becomes less critical, but for now, picking an ecosystem and sticking with it simplifies the smart home tech experience.
Essential Smart Devices For Beginners
Beginners should start with a few high-impact devices rather than overhauling everything at once. The following smart home tech products offer immediate benefits without steep learning curves.
Smart Speakers
A voice assistant serves as the foundation. Amazon Echo Dot, Google Nest Mini, and Apple HomePod Mini all cost under $100 and provide voice control for compatible devices. They also answer questions, play music, and set timers, useful features even without other smart home tech.
Smart Lighting
Smart bulbs deliver visible results quickly. Philips Hue, LIFX, and Wyze offer options at various price points. Users can dim lights, set schedules, and create scenes for different activities. Some bulbs require a hub: others connect directly to Wi-Fi.
Smart Plugs
These inexpensive devices convert any outlet into a smart outlet. Lamps, fans, and coffee makers gain on/off control through apps or voice commands. Smart plugs also track energy consumption, helpful for identifying power-hungry appliances.
Smart Thermostats
Nest, Ecobee, and Honeywell thermostats learn household patterns and adjust temperatures automatically. Most users see 10-15% reductions in heating and cooling costs. Installation takes about 30 minutes for those comfortable with basic wiring.
Smart Doorbells
Ring and Nest doorbells show visitors on smartphone screens. Motion alerts notify homeowners of package deliveries or unexpected guests. Two-way audio allows conversations without opening the door.
Start with one or two categories. Master those before expanding. This approach prevents frustration and builds confidence with smart home tech gradually.
Setting Up Your Smart Home Network
A reliable network forms the backbone of smart home tech. Slow Wi-Fi or dead zones cause devices to disconnect and automations to fail. Investing in network infrastructure pays dividends.
Most homes benefit from a mesh Wi-Fi system. Brands like Eero, Google Nest Wifi, and Orbi place multiple access points throughout the house, eliminating coverage gaps. These systems handle dozens of connected devices without slowdowns.
Follow these steps for optimal setup:
- Position the router centrally. Signals travel in all directions, so a central location provides the best coverage.
- Create a separate network for smart devices. Many routers support multiple SSIDs. Keeping smart home tech on its own 2.4GHz network prevents interference with computers and phones on 5GHz.
- Assign static IP addresses to critical devices like hubs. This prevents connection issues when DHCP leases expire.
- Update firmware regularly. Manufacturers release patches for security vulnerabilities and performance improvements.
- Use strong, unique passwords. Every device with a default password represents a security risk.
Security deserves special attention. Smart home tech creates potential entry points for hackers. Enable two-factor authentication on all accounts. Review privacy settings and disable features that send unnecessary data to manufacturers. Consider a network firewall for additional protection.
A well-configured network makes smart home tech reliable and secure. Spending an hour on setup prevents countless headaches later.
Tips For Seamless Automation
Automation transforms smart home tech from convenient to magical. Instead of manually controlling each device, the home responds to conditions and schedules automatically.
Start with time-based routines. A “Good Morning” routine might turn on lights, read the weather forecast, and start the coffee maker at 6:30 AM. A “Goodnight” routine could lock doors, turn off lights, and lower the thermostat. These simple automations provide daily value.
Sensor-triggered actions add another layer. Motion sensors can:
- Turn on hallway lights when someone walks by at night
- Activate cameras when movement occurs outside
- Trigger alerts when doors or windows open unexpectedly
Location-based (geofencing) automations use smartphone GPS. The thermostat adjusts when the last person leaves home. Lights turn on automatically when someone arrives after dark. These “set and forget” routines save energy and improve security.
Advanced users link multiple triggers and conditions. “If it’s after sunset AND motion is detected in the backyard AND the security system is armed, THEN turn on floodlights and send a notification.” Platforms like IFTTT, Home Assistant, and native app routines enable these complex automations.
A few practical tips make automation smoother:
- Test thoroughly before relying on critical automations like security alerts
- Build gradually, complex routines break more often
- Document your setup so you remember why automations exist
- Leave manual overrides available for guests and edge cases
Great smart home tech automation should be invisible. Family members shouldn’t need to think about it, the home just works.
